Transaction 51a98ba05377da52432dd42fe7b983d999800248d0cb9bb8b3780c56ac14ff16

1 Input
2 Outputs
  • 51a98ba05377da52432dd42fe7b983d999800248d0cb9bb8b3780c56ac14ff16:0
  • value  8122510
    address  34cn2XaaDkrLCp3rfyX5KkVHJPwF9ER1eq
  • 51a98ba05377da52432dd42fe7b983d999800248d0cb9bb8b3780c56ac14ff16:1
  • value  3035761514
    address  1Gq5rKonaadx7cExuHCegU7Xn4V81GU1z9